And though African-American cowboys don’t play a part in the popular narrative, historians estimate that one in four … The origins of the cowboy tradition come from Spain, beginning with the hacienda system of medieval Spain. This style of cattle ranching spread throughout much of the Iberian peninsula, and later was imported to the Americas.
